Michael J. Dreslik
About
Michael J. Dreslik has authored 43 papers that have received a total of 731 indexed citations.
This includes 34 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ation, 30 papers in Ecology and 30 papers in Global and Planetary Change. The topics of these papers are Amphibian and Reptile Biology (30 papers), Turtle Biology and Conservation (27 papers) and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(20 papers). Michael J. Dreslik is often cited by papers focused on Amphibian and Reptile Biology (30 papers), Turtle Biology and Conservation (27 papers) and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(20 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, Belgium and South Africa. Michael J. Dreslik's co-authors include Christopher A. Phillips, Matthew C. Allender, Donald B. Shepard, Andrew R. Kuhns and Jason P. Ross and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Wildlife Management and Copeia.
